Locals Swear This Mountain-View Breakfast Buffet In Vermont Feels Straight Out Of A Movie

Nestled in the hills of Stowe, Vermont, the von Trapp Family Lodge offers a breakfast experience that feels like a scene from a classic film. The Main Dining Room overlooks the Green Mountains, and morning light spills through large windows, illuminating rustic wood-paneled walls.

Guests often pause mid-bite just to admire the view. It’s not unusual to hear someone humming “Edelweiss” while sipping coffee. The atmosphere is cozy and relaxed, with friendly staff welcoming guests like old friends.

Whether you’re staying at the lodge or just visiting for breakfast, the setting alone makes it worth the trip. The vibe is warm and communal, perfect for lingering over a second helping. It’s a peaceful way to start your day in Vermont.

1. A Buffet That’s Big on Flavor

A Buffet That’s Big on Flavor

The breakfast buffet is served daily from 7:30 to 10:30 a.m., and it’s packed with Vermont-style favorites. You’ll find scrambled eggs, crispy bacon, sausage links, and golden pancakes ready to fuel your mountain adventures.

There’s also French toast, waffles, and hot and cold cereals for every kind of breakfast lover. Fresh fruit and pastries round out the spread, offering sweet bites alongside hearty fare. Everything is prepared with care, and the quality is consistently praised by guests.

The buffet is self-serve, so you can build your plate exactly how you like it. It’s a great option for families, couples, and solo travelers alike. No one leaves hungry, and many come back for seconds.

8. A Setting That Tells a Story

A Setting That Tells a Story

The dining room itself is steeped in history and charm. Wood-paneled walls, mountain views, and cozy décor create a timeless ambiance. It reflects the Austrian heritage of the von Trapp family, whose story inspired “The Sound of Music.”

Guests often feel like they’ve stepped into a storybook. The room is spacious yet intimate, perfect for quiet mornings or lively conversations. Seasonal decorations add a festive touch throughout the year. It’s a place where memories are made over morning coffee. The setting enhances every bite.
